SBIO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review
47 of the 4,538 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ALPS Medical Breakthroughs ETF (SBIO)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$45M — down 19% from $55.2M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 13 funds closed out of SBIO and 11 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 16 trimmed existing stakes and 9 added.
The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, opening a new position worth an estimated $3.64M. The largest seller was Cardan Capital Partners, cutting an estimated $1.01M.
